Merge branch 'hn/reftable'
The "reftable" backend for the refs API, without integrating into
the refs subsystem, has been added.
* hn/reftable:
Add "test-tool dump-reftable" command.
reftable: add dump utility
reftable: implement stack, a mutable database of reftable files.
reftable: implement refname validation
reftable: add merged table view
reftable: add a heap-based priority queue for reftable records
reftable: reftable file level tests
reftable: read reftable files
reftable: generic interface to tables
reftable: write reftable files
reftable: a generic binary tree implementation
reftable: reading/writing blocks
Provide zlib's uncompress2 from compat/zlib-compat.c
reftable: (de)serialization for the polymorphic record type.
reftable: add blocksource, an abstraction for random access reads
reftable: utility functions
reftable: add error related functionality
reftable: add LICENSE
hash.h: provide constants for the hash IDs

diff --git a/reftable/reftable-error.h b/reftable/reftable-error.h new file mode 100644 index 0000000000..6f89bedf1a --- /dev/null +++ b/reftable/reftable-error.h @@ -0,0 +1,62 @@ +/* +Copyright 2020 Google LLC + +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style +license that can be found in the LICENSE file or at +https://developers.google.com/open-source/licenses/bsd +*/ + +#ifndef REFTABLE_ERROR_H +#define REFTABLE_ERROR_H + +/* + * Errors in reftable calls are signaled with negative integer return values. 0 + * means success. + */ +enum reftable_error { + /* Unexpected file system behavior */ + REFTABLE_IO_ERROR = -2, + + /* Format inconsistency on reading data */ + REFTABLE_FORMAT_ERROR = -3, + + /* File does not exist. Returned from block_source_from_file(), because + * it needs special handling in stack. + */ + REFTABLE_NOT_EXIST_ERROR = -4, + + /* Trying to write out-of-date data. */ + REFTABLE_LOCK_ERROR = -5, + + /* Misuse of the API: + * - on writing a record with NULL refname. + * - on writing a reftable_ref_record outside the table limits + * - on writing a ref or log record before the stack's + * next_update_inde*x + * - on writing a log record with multiline message with + * exact_log_message unset + * - on reading a reftable_ref_record from log iterator, or vice versa. + * + * When a call misuses the API, the internal state of the library is + * kept unchanged. + */ + REFTABLE_API_ERROR = -6, + + /* Decompression error */ + REFTABLE_ZLIB_ERROR = -7, + + /* Wrote a table without blocks. */ + REFTABLE_EMPTY_TABLE_ERROR = -8, + + /* Dir/file conflict. */ + REFTABLE_NAME_CONFLICT = -9, + + /* Invalid ref name. */ + REFTABLE_REFNAME_ERROR = -10, +}; + +/* convert the numeric error code to a string. The string should not be + * deallocated. */ +const char *reftable_error_str(int err); + +#endif |
